When thinking about all of the different elements of an effective classroom, we tend to plan for the big items: procedures, routines, and activities. And while those are important, have you ever thought about the transitions between each activity or procedure? It’s not a teaching element that gets much thought, but having effective classroom transitions makes for a smooth and efficient all-around classroom. Since we find classroom transitions so important, we’re starting a 3 part series on them. Research has shown that there are 3 characteristics of efficient transitions, which are clear beginnings and ends, how quickly they’re accomplished, and minimizing the amount of downtime between activities. In today’s episode, we’re focusing on the first characteristic, which involves clear beginnings and endings. The recipe for a successful classroom includes a mixture of procedures, lesson plans, activities, and relationships. But the top secret ingredient? Student engagement. In order to accomplish this in your classroom, it requires a balance between novelty and routine. We’ve talked a lot about routine and procedures in the classroom in past episodes, so today we’re sharing how novelty plays a role to increase student engagement in a productive classroom. If you think of student engagement as a scale, by adding novelty to your day, you’re providing an element of surprise that piques their interest. A term used in the business world addresses this situation, which is called surprise and delight. By creating surprise and delight in the classroom it does two things: changes behavior and strengthens relationships. In keeping those in mind, we share 5 ways to apply surprise and delight in your classroom that helps increase student engagement and keeps the scale balanced. We’ve all heard the saying your brain is like a muscle. But what does that truly mean? Basically, the more we use it, the stronger it gets. We can apply this same theory to retrieval practice, which is when we give students an opportunity to access information they previously learned from their long-term memory. Every time students access this information it becomes easier to retrieve in the future. Connect with us on Instagram @2ndstorywindow .
